Course Description

• Financial literacy is an essential life skill that enables individuals to make informed and effective decisions about managing money. For school teachers, understanding financial concepts and  modeling responsible financial behaviour can have a powerful ripple effect, shaping students’ attitudes and abilities to handle money wisely from a young age.

• This course is designed to help teachers integrate financial literacy into their classrooms through simple concepts, practical examples, and classroom acti activities that are age-appropriate and relevant to the Indian context. It supports the goals of the National Strategy for Financial Education (NSFE 2020–2025) and aligns with the National Education Policy (NEP 2020) focus on life skills and value-based learning.

• The course provides a foundation in personal finance, from budgeting, saving, and credit management to entrepreneurship and planning for financial independence. Teachers will also explore ways to connect these topics with subjects such as maths and social studies and mathematics.

What You will Learn?

1. Demonstrate their understanding of the core concepts of financial literacy , including budgeting, saving, borrowing, investing, and planning for the future.
2. Recognize the importance of cultivating financial awareness and responsibility among students.
3. Integrate financial literacy themes into classroom lessons and real-life learning experiences.
4. Develop practical classroom strategies to teach money management, goal setting, and ethical financial behavior.
5. Model sound financial habits and promote values such as honesty, discipline, and long-term planning.
6. Encourage students to think critically about financial decisions and understand their social and emotional dimensions.
